I'm trying to make sense of all the information reported.
- Aug. 10 ~9:30 PM: Matthew was seen on the 2600 block of Stearns St. in Simi Valley. [Unclear if a witness saw him, or they have security footage. There is an In-N-Out at 2600 Stearns.]
- Aug. 10 - time unknown: Matthew's last SnapChat was in the general location of where his car was found.
- Aug. 11 ~midnight: A witness calls 911 after hearing a cry for help/screams near Stunt and Shueren Rd. (where his car was found).
- Aug. 11 ~2:00 AM: First responders arrive and at least two (CHP and Fire) hear screams/cries for help.
- Aug. 11 - "morning": Matthew's car is found by hikers, "stuck on a small hiking trail near the Rosas Overlook. Authorities responded to what they thought was a traffic accident". [Unclear if this is the same person who heard cries and called 911.]
- Aug. 11 ~3:00 AM: Matthew's car was found with the right front tire hanging over the cliff. All windows were rolled up and doors locked. His keys, wallet, phone and clothing have not been found. [This is from the page. Are hikers really out at 3 in the morning?]
